Revelling in the wonder of aviation history, Call Sign debuts its immersive Wrights of Passage series, crafted in tribute to the Wright Brothers and their family.

Call Sign, formerly known as Bravo Golf, is an independent watch brand that has a deep-rooted passion for aviation. This admiration is beautifully embodied in their latest series, ‘The Wrights of Passage’. This collection, produced under its original name Bravo Golf, as marked on each dial, was summoned into being in association with the Wright Brothers Family Foundation. Each model from the series serves as a tribute to the family that soared to unprecedented heights, shaping the very genesis of powered flight.

The collection organizers’ core belief is that watches should encapsulate stories rather than merely specs. The toe-curling tales entrenched in the Wrights of Passage series caught the Wright Brothers Family Foundation’s attention. Consequently, this led to a collaborative milestone that saw the birth of this revolutionary collection aimed at honoring the Wright family’s legacy.

The Wrights of Passage series echoes the energy of its namesake. It positively teems with historical cachet, each model reflecting a different chapter of the Wright family’s journey. The ‘Brothers’ edition pays homage to Wilbur and Orville Wright, mimicking the darkened shades of their Dayton workshop. On the other hand, the ‘Katharine’ variant applauds Katharine Wright’s indispensable role in her brothers’ achievements, while the ‘Bishop’ shines the spotlight on family patriarch Milton Wright.
